Output 80be848aa7af1742657aec6b9c6bbca19c4d9afd6492f553770102e06c066c4c:26

value
94206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d4104a115b177ad8754770dda640d33a48aa64 OP_EQUAL
address
3JpAKrZkUv5ygHzNiqTftCsPm8BqUyzBNH
transaction
80be848aa7af1742657aec6b9c6bbca19c4d9afd6492f553770102e06c066c4c
confirmations
250492
spent
true